The Building Resilient Infrastructure and Communities (BRIC) Grant will help to support states, local communities, tribes and territories, as they undertake Hazard Mitigation projects that will reduce the risks they face from disasters and natural hazards. The Hazard Mitigation Grant Program provides funds to states, territories, tribal governments, and other communities after a disaster, to reduce or eliminate future risk to lives and property from natural hazards. Federal funding under the HMGP is based on 7.5 percent of the federal funds spent on the Public and Individual Assistance programs (minus administrative expenses) for each disaster. For most of the storm shelters Dome Technology builds, grant money covers 75 percent of the cost of the shell; this requires the balance plus interior finishing to be funded in other ways. To be eligible, a shelter must be located in a neighborhood or park that contains at least 20 units, consists predominately of low- and moderate-income households and is in a state where a tornado has occurred within the current year or lastthree years. Federal funding is available for as much as 75 percent of eligible costs; however, small impoverished communities may be eligible for as much as 90 percent Federal cost share.
